As is the case with most films based on literature, ACO feels too abridged and lacks a lot of what makes Burgess’s novel so powerful (eg Alex’s character arc, more dialogue on choosing to be good vs being forced to be good, the treatment process, time spent with F. Alexander etc).
While Kubrick’s version is still an entertaining set of audiovisuals (minus the depictions of rape), the storyline just feels too rushed.
